Here The Pros and Cons of Kia Carens Clavis 1.5L Naturally Aspirated Petrol

Pros 

  • Affordability: This variant is the most budget-friendly option in the Carens Clavis lineup, making it a highly accessible choice for families seeking a feature-rich 6/7-seater MPV.
  • Smooth and Refined Engine: The naturally aspirated engine is known for its smooth operation and good refinement, making for a comfortable and quiet city driving experience.
  • Practicality and Features: Even in its base and mid-level trims, the 1.5L NA petrol variant benefits from the Carens' core strengths, including a spacious and comfortable cabin, a usable third row, and a decent list of standard safety and convenience features.
  • Lower Maintenance Costs: As a simpler, non-turbocharged engine, it generally has lower long-term maintenance costs and is less complex to service compared to the turbo-petrol and diesel options.

 

Cons 

  • Underpowered Performance: The biggest drawback is the engine's lack of power and torque, especially when the car is fully loaded with passengers and luggage. It struggles with quick overtakes on highways and on inclines.
  • Sluggish on Highways: While adequate for city commuting, the engine feels strained at high speeds and for long highway journeys, requiring frequent downshifts to maintain momentum.
  • Poor Fuel Economy: Despite being a naturally aspirated engine, its real-world mileage can be disappointing, especially in stop-and-go city traffic or when the car is driven with a heavy foot to compensate for the lack of power.
